Abstract
The effective conductivity of composite materials with random position n 2,n ∈ N, and the cylindrical identical inclusions inside periodic cells is considered. We compare the results for symmetric and nonsymmetric cases of location of the inclusions in the cells and find that a symmetric structure provides a minimum for the effective conductivity among all the structures having n 2 inclusions of such conductivity and sizes.
